Come see Shenton Park's 'little secret'! Behind the wall of 331 is a traditional 'cottage style' family home that used to be 'Heritage Listed' and is built on a potentially subdividable 795m2 block!

Right next door to Rankin Reserve and additional access to the home is via the laneway off Waylen Road and Gray Street.

OPTION 1: Yes, there is work to be done however, the original home has special features such as the beautiful ornate ceilings, stunning timber floorboards & a gorgeous fireplace. This property is being sold 'as is' so if you do decide to renovate, this home has ample space for the whole family and a spacious 'garden filled' sunroom too. 5 good size bedrooms, 2 bathrooms, 2 living areas & room for a few cars too.

OPTION 2: Potentially subdivide into two lots and having the rear laneway is certainly an added BONUS!

OPTION 3: You could demolish and build your 'dream home'.

THE CHOICE IS YOURS!

Located in the sought-after suburb of Shenton Park, this property is surrounded by an array of amenities. Walking distance to Shenton Park College, close proximity to the bus stop & train station, next to a park and near Lake Jualbup, shops, cafes & restaurants and medical & hospitals too.

A block's planning zone defines how that land can be used and what can be built on it.
A right to use a part of land owned by another person for a specific purpose. The most common forms of easements are for services, such as water, electricity or sewerage.
The value of a block of land without any buildings, landscaping, paths, or fences. This is different to the block's market value. A block's unimproved value is used to calculate rates and land tax charges.
This represents the shape of the geographical land. Closely spaced contour lines represent a steep slope. Widely spaced lines represent a gentle slope.
